Essential Tools for Stardew Valley Sprinkling

Efficiently watering your crops is key to success in Stardew Valley. Sprinklers are invaluable tools for this task. They automate a daily chore, saving precious in-game time. Knowing each sprinkler's range helps you maximize planting space.

Using quality sprinklers means more time for other activities. You can focus on mining, fishing, or building relationships. Proper sprinkler placement ensures all your plants thrive effortlessly. It is a smart investment for any serious farmer.

Sprinkler TypeUnlock Level/CraftingWatering RangeCost/Requirements
Basic SprinklerFarming Level 28 tiles (3x3 square)Iron Bar (1), Copper Bar (1)
Quality SprinklerFarming Level 624 tiles (5x5 square)Iron Bar (1), Gold Bar (1)
Iridium SprinklerFarming Level 948 tiles (7x7 square)Gold Bar (1), Iridium Bar (1), Battery Pack (1)

What is the best farm layout for Stardew Valley?

The best Stardew Valley farm layout depends on your playstyle. Forest Farm is great for foraging, while Riverland suits fishing enthusiasts. Standard Farm offers maximum planting space. Consider your main activities to choose a layout that complements them. Planning helps optimize both beauty and efficiency. Many players enjoy mixing design with practicality.

Can you move buildings in Stardew Valley?

Yes, you can move most buildings in Stardew Valley. Visit Robin at the Carpenter's Shop. Select the "Construct Farm Buildings" option, then click on the building you wish to relocate. This service is free after construction. It allows for flexible farm design and reorganization. Moving buildings helps optimize your layout as your farm grows. It ensures your farm always suits your needs.
